-
时光巷陌
- 大数据存储方案的编写是一个复杂的过程,涉及到数据模型设计、存储技术选择、数据管理策略等多个方面。以下是一些关键点和建议,可以帮助你编写一个有效的大数据存储方案: 需求分析:首先,明确你的大数据存储方案需要解决什么问题,比如是处理海量日志数据、实时流数据还是离线批处理数据。了解数据的来源、类型、规模以及预期的增长趋势。 数据模型设计:根据数据的特点选择合适的数据模型。对于结构化数据,可以使用关系型数据库;对于半结构化或非结构化数据,可以考虑使用NOSQL数据库或文档存储系统。 存储技术选择:选择合适的存储技术,如HADOOP分布式文件系统(HDFS)、AMAZON S3、OPENSTACK NOSTALGIA等。考虑数据访问模式、读写性能、可扩展性、容错能力等因素。 数据分区与分片:为了提高数据的读写效率,可以采用数据分区和分片技术。将数据分散到不同的存储节点上,以减少单个节点的负载。 数据压缩与优化:对于大规模数据集,数据压缩可以显著减少存储空间的需求。同时,利用高效的索引、查询优化和缓存机制来提升数据处理速度。 数据安全与备份:确保数据的安全性和完整性。实施数据加密、访问控制和定期备份策略。 监控与维护:建立监控系统来跟踪存储的性能指标,如IOPS(每秒输入/输出操作数)、响应时间、吞吐量等。定期进行维护和升级,以应对数据量的增长和技术的发展。 灾难恢复计划:制定灾难恢复计划,确保在发生故障时能够快速恢复服务。 法律与合规性:确保存储方案符合相关的法律法规要求,特别是涉及个人隐私和敏感信息的处理。 用户友好性:设计易于使用的界面和工具,以便用户能够轻松地管理和查询数据。 编写大数据存储方案时,需要综合考虑上述各个方面,并根据具体的业务需求和技术环境进行调整。此外,随着技术的不断发展,新的存储技术和工具也在不断涌现,持续关注行业动态并适时更新方案也是必要的。
-
枕五月
- 大数据存储方案的编写是一个复杂的过程,需要综合考虑数据的规模、类型、访问模式以及性能需求。以下是一些建议和步骤,可以帮助你编写一个有效的大数据存储方案: 需求分析: (1) 确定数据的类型和来源,例如结构化数据、半结构化数据或非结构化数据。 (2) 分析数据的访问模式,包括查询频率、更新频率等。 (3) 评估数据量的大小,以及预期的数据增长趋势。 数据模型设计: (1) 根据数据的特点选择合适的数据模型,如键值对、文档、列族等。 (2) 设计合理的数据结构以支持高效的查询和索引。 存储架构选择: (1) 选择合适的存储技术,如分布式文件系统(如HDFS)、对象存储(如AMAZON S3)、数据库(如HADOOP HBASE、CASSANDRA)等。 (2) 考虑使用云存储服务,如AWS S3、GOOGLE CLOUD STORAGE等,以便利用其弹性和可扩展性。 数据分片与副本策略: (1) 根据数据访问模式和一致性要求设计数据分片策略。 (2) 确定副本策略,包括主副本、辅助副本和只读副本,以提高数据的可用性和容错能力。 索引与查询优化: (1) 为常用查询创建合适的索引,以提高查询效率。 (2) 实施查询优化,如使用MAPREDUCE进行批处理、使用APACHE SPARK进行实时查询等。 监控与调优: (1) 定期监控存储系统的健康状况和性能指标。 (2) 根据监控结果调整存储参数,如调整副本数量、调整数据分片大小等。 安全性与合规性: (1) 确保存储解决方案符合相关的数据保护法规和标准。 (2) 实施加密、访问控制和其他安全措施来保护数据。 灾难恢复计划: (1) 制定并测试灾难恢复计划,确保在发生故障时能够快速恢复数据和服务。 成本管理: (1) 评估存储解决方案的成本效益,包括硬件、软件、维护和运营成本。 (2) 考虑长期成本,确保存储解决方案的可持续性。 迭代与升级: (1) 根据业务发展和技术进步,不断迭代和升级存储解决方案。 (2) 保持对新技术的关注,如云计算、人工智能等,以便将它们集成到存储解决方案中。 编写大数据存储方案时,重要的是要考虑到数据的多样性和复杂性,以及用户的需求和期望。通过上述步骤,你可以创建一个既高效又可靠的大数据存储解决方案。
-
鸾月
- 大数据存储方案的编写需要综合考虑数据的规模、类型、访问模式以及性能和成本等多个因素。以下是一些关键步骤和考虑点: 确定数据模型:根据数据的特点选择合适的数据模型,如关系型数据库、非关系型数据库(NOSQL)或文档存储等。 数据存储策略:决定是使用分布式文件系统还是传统的关系型数据库。分布式文件系统适合处理大规模数据,而关系型数据库更适合结构化数据。 数据分区与分片:对于海量数据,将数据分散到多个节点上可以显著提高查询效率。分片技术允许将数据分布在不同的服务器上,以实现水平扩展。 数据压缩:为了减少存储空间和提高读取速度,可以使用各种压缩算法对数据进行压缩。 数据一致性和事务管理:确保数据的一致性和完整性,特别是在分布式环境中,需要设计合适的事务管理和故障恢复机制。 性能优化:通过索引、缓存、查询优化等手段提升数据检索速度。 安全性和隐私保护:确保数据的安全性和隐私性,包括加密存储、访问控制和审计日志等。 监控与维护:建立监控系统来跟踪数据存储的性能和健康状况,及时进行维护和升级。 成本效益分析:评估不同存储方案的成本,包括硬件投资、运维费用、扩展性和维护成本等。 法规遵从性:确保存储方案符合相关的法律法规要求,特别是涉及个人数据和敏感信息时。 灾难恢复计划:制定灾难恢复计划以应对可能的数据丢失或系统故障。 可扩展性和灵活性:选择能够适应未来数据增长和技术发展的存储解决方案。 在编写大数据存储方案时,应详细描述每个组件的选择理由、预期效果、潜在风险以及实施步骤。此外,还应考虑到技术的更新换代,确保所选方案在未来几年内仍然有效。
免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。
区块链相关问答
- 2026-03-13 大数据职称评级怎么评(如何评定大数据领域的职称等级?)
大数据职称评级的评定过程通常涉及以下几个步骤: 资格审核:首先,需要确认申请者是否满足评定职称的基本条件,包括教育背景、工作经验和专业技能等。 资料提交:申请者需要提交相关的证明材料,如学历证明、工作证明、专业资...
- 2026-03-13 培训大数据怎么样子(如何有效培训以应对大数据时代的挑战?)
培训大数据是指通过收集、分析和利用大量的数据来改进和优化培训过程。以下是一些关于如何有效使用培训大数据的要点: 数据收集:首先,需要收集与培训相关的各种数据,包括参与者的学习进度、成绩、反馈、互动情况等。这些数据可以...
- 2026-03-13 c语言大数据怎么读取(如何高效地从C语言中读取大数据?)
在C语言中,读取大数据通常涉及到文件操作。以下是一个简单的示例,展示了如何使用C语言从文件中读取数据: #INCLUDE <STDIO.H> INT MAIN() { FILE *F...
- 2026-03-13 区块链是什么虚拟币(区块链是什么?它与虚拟货币有何关联?)
区块链是一种分布式数据库技术,它通过加密算法将数据打包成一个个“区块”,并将这些区块按照时间顺序连接起来形成一个链条,这就是所谓的“区块链”。每个区块都包含了一定数量的交易记录,这些记录一旦被写入,就无法被篡改。因此,区...
- 2026-03-13 区块链什么是智能合约(智能合约是什么?区块链中的智能合约是如何运作的?)
智能合约是一种基于区块链技术的自动执行合同条款的技术。它允许在没有第三方介入的情况下,通过编程的方式定义和执行交易条件。智能合约通常使用编程语言编写,如SOLIDITY或JAVASCRIPT,并部署在区块链平台上,如以太...
- 2026-03-13 大数据专业怎么写项目(如何撰写一个引人入胜的大数据项目计划书?)
大数据项目通常涉及数据的收集、存储、处理、分析和可视化。撰写一个实用且有效的大数据项目计划,需要遵循以下步骤: 项目背景与目标: 描述项目的背景信息,包括业务需求、市场环境、技术趋势等。 明确项目的目标和预期成果。...
- 推荐搜索问题
- 区块链最新问答
-

万物不如你 回答于03-13

温柔宠溺 回答于03-13

区块链什么是智能合约(智能合约是什么?区块链中的智能合约是如何运作的?)
月戟消逝 回答于03-13

`痞子゛ 回答于03-13

上沢川 回答于03-13

浪野少女心 回答于03-13

竹泣墨痕 回答于03-13

云上写诗 回答于03-13

你多无辜 回答于03-13

区块链电子发票是什么(区块链电子发票:是什么?它如何改变我们处理发票的方式?)
黑色指针 回答于03-13
- 北京区块链
- 天津区块链
- 上海区块链
- 重庆区块链
- 深圳区块链
- 河北区块链
- 石家庄区块链
- 山西区块链
- 太原区块链
- 辽宁区块链
- 沈阳区块链
- 吉林区块链
- 长春区块链
- 黑龙江区块链
- 哈尔滨区块链
- 江苏区块链
- 南京区块链
- 浙江区块链
- 杭州区块链
- 安徽区块链
- 合肥区块链
- 福建区块链
- 福州区块链
- 江西区块链
- 南昌区块链
- 山东区块链
- 济南区块链
- 河南区块链
- 郑州区块链
- 湖北区块链
- 武汉区块链
- 湖南区块链
- 长沙区块链
- 广东区块链
- 广州区块链
- 海南区块链
- 海口区块链
- 四川区块链
- 成都区块链
- 贵州区块链
- 贵阳区块链
- 云南区块链
- 昆明区块链
- 陕西区块链
- 西安区块链
- 甘肃区块链
- 兰州区块链
- 青海区块链
- 西宁区块链
- 内蒙古区块链
- 呼和浩特区块链
- 广西区块链
- 南宁区块链
- 西藏区块链
- 拉萨区块链
- 宁夏区块链
- 银川区块链
- 新疆区块链
- 乌鲁木齐区块链


